Transaction 64d90b32d3a85192780326523a4533288ca5f3f9928509f57e3cdd0c2980127d
1 Input
2 Outputs
- 64d90b32d3a85192780326523a4533288ca5f3f9928509f57e3cdd0c2980127d:0
- 64d90b32d3a85192780326523a4533288ca5f3f9928509f57e3cdd0c2980127d:1
value 51527896
address 2NDZseX9fwtb8dUnVu8Boeq3oM1G2XtC9wW
value 200531133894
address miS1W1yFy3wf9GtfYJGp7ERK3BuZmRNwre